At a recent live presentation of Funcom`s Age of Conan, Gaute Godager and Erling Ellingsen demonstrated the different forms of combat in their game. In part one of the presentation the guys talked primarily about the melee combat combo system and the aimable ranged combat.

Video Interview Combat Part One
During a recent live presentation, Age of Conan's Gaute Godager and Erling Ellingsen spoke about the different kinds of combat in the game. In part one of this video, they talk about ranged and melee combat.

AoC combat is sure among the most exciting these days. However I just sincerely advise everyone who plays it to buy a Logitech gamepad and program your combos. Its WAY too much key juggling otherwise, with a gamepad you just program a line of keys into one, and unlike the keyboard with a gamepad each button is close enough. After half an hour AoC PVP always my left hand hurt like hell.

As to the shields... I found them kinda pointless. Its fun and cool to react to the enemies shield change, but myself... I never found myself able to predict from what angle an enemy would attack in time. *shrug* Cant imagine anyone besides a Jedi who forsees the future to make serious use of this feature on your own shields.
